abpdev-add-package
software-developers

Add NuGet packages with abpdev and automatically wire ABP module dependencies. Use when the user wants to install a package from any NuGet source, target one or many projects, control restore/version behavior, or troubleshoot DependsOn updates.

abpdev-environments
software-developers

Manage AbpDevTools virtual environments and environment apps with abpdev. Use when the user wants to configure connection-string environments, start/stop Docker-backed infra tools, or open a shell with a selected environment.

abpdev-maintenance
software-developers

Use AbpDevTools maintenance and utility commands such as clean, replace, tools/config, notifications, update, find-file, find-port, and ABP Studio switching. Use when the user wants repo cleanup, config-driven text replacement, process/port inspection, tool updates, or local tool-path setup.

abpdev-migrations
software-developers

Manage EF Core migrations and database drops across multiple ABP projects. Use when the user wants to add, clear, recreate migrations, or drop databases for one or many EntityFrameworkCore projects.

abpdev-references
software-developers

Switch between NuGet package references and local project references using the abpdev CLI. Use when the user wants to configure local-sources.yml, convert packages to local project references, convert back to package references, debug ABP source locally, use the local-sources config alias, or troubleshoot reference switching in ABP-based projects.

abpdev-workflow
software-developers

Run the core AbpDevTools developer workflow commands: build, run, test, prepare, logs, and bundle. Use when the user wants to build or run ABP solutions, prepare a machine, inspect logs, or handle Blazor WASM bundling.
